SW Steakhouse
When dining out at new places, your best bet is to get recommendations from people you know or online reviews. SW Steakhouse has over 2000 online reviews on TripAdvisor, ranking it 4.5 stars (out of 5) and many awards. The restaurant was named the "Best Steakhouse" by the Southern Nevada Hotel Concierge Association four times. Additionally, they are a Travelers Choice 2021 winner on TripAdvisor.
The SW Steakhouse, located in the Wynn Las Vegas & Encore Resort, ranks as the No. 1 steakhouse with outdoor seating in Las Vegas, Nevada.
Fine dining doesn't get any better than this. Guests love the service and the elegant decor.
Reviewers on TripAdvisor love the prime-aged steaks and chops, the seafood such as crab cakes and pan-roasted scallops, and the appetizers including caviar, oysters, shrimp, and lobster.
Additionally, they have an extensive selection of decadent desserts and an impressive whisky, cocktail, and wine list.
SW Steakhouse is suitable for special occasions or any night you feel like a treat if you are after an upscale steakhouse with gorgeous ambiance and exceptional food.
Make sure to reserve a table early; it can get busy, and be sure to request the outdoor patio dining, which features views of the Lake of Dreams and a lit waterfall.
3131 Las Vegas Blvd S Wynn Las Vegas, Las Vegas, Nevada.

Echo and Rig
Another Travelers Choice 2021 winner on TripAdvisor, Echo and Rig is the go-to place when it comes to modern steakhouses. Boasting their acclaimed in-house butcher, a large open glass meat locker, and an exhibition/demonstration area, not only will you be well-fed, but you will be entertained.
Echo and Rig is just 15 minutes from the Las Vegas Strip and is open for brunch and dinner.
Menu highlights include Colorado Lamb Porterhouse Chops, Kurobuta Pork Chop, Baby Back Ribs, Slow Roasted Mary's Chicken Breast, Shrimp & Artichokes, Organic King Salmon, Diver Scallops* plus delicious fresh cuts of steaks.
On top of that, they have an extensive craft beer and cocktail menu, including the bottomless Bloody Mary.
The butcher shop is available for take-out orders, so make sure to pick up some fresh cuts of homemade sausages before you head home.

440 S Rampart, at Tivoli Village, Las Vegas, Nevada.
Prime Steakhouse
Boasting an extensive menu of seafood and meat cuts, Prime Steakhouse offers excellent service and outdoor seating on the patio with a view of the Bellagio Fountain Show. That is, in our books, a reason to make sure you go to this restaurant at least once.
Diners love the seafood, including the shrimp cocktails, tuna tartare, oysters, and chilled shellfish platters.
Additionally, they rave about the steaks, some claiming it is the best steak in Vegas.
To top it off, the desserts are absolutely decadent, so make sure you leave room for the extra treat.
3600 Las Vegas Blvd S Bellagio Hotel and Casino, Las Vegas, Nevada.
